Yankees Lead PawSox After Four 2-1

The Scranton/Wilkes-Barre Yankees lead the PawSox 2-1 after four innings tonight at McCoy.

The Yankees scored their runs in the top of the fourth on a two-run home run by 1B Juan Miranda.  Pawtucket responded in the bottom of the frame on a solo shot by Brian Anderson.

Enrique Gonzalez has given up three runs through four innings, walking four and striking out one.  He has thrown 61 pitches, 34 for srikes.
